Facilities Mechanical Engineerは広島工場内のプロセス/設備/製造の流れを理解したうえで, 機械システムの改修, 新規導入と最適で安全な制御設計を行い各種プロジェクトを遂行します。
また, トラブル対策• 最適運転管理を行う為 専門知識を利用し, 改善業務を行うと共に, 運用コストの削減を図ります。さらに関連するリスク低減を図り, 災害• 事故を撲滅して安全で快適な職場環境を作り, またAIを使用しての業務改善改善活動も行います。
業務内容
  • 法令を遵守し, 安全を考慮した設備計画• 設計の実施
  • 安全衛生基準• 環境基準の理解と遵守
  • 技術的将来計画やロードマップについて説明
  • 法令• 規則を遵守した設計• 許可書類の作成
  • 設計• 施工に対する仕様書の作成
  • 設計図面の取り纏め
  • プロジェクトマネージメントに従ったプロジェクトの推進 (Scope/Budget/Scheduleの管理)
  • 設備性能検査方法の決定
  • カスタマーの要求の把握
  • トラブル発生時に技術的な対策及び横展開
  • 統計的データーに基づいた品質管理
  • コスト• 省エネ• 環境管理活動の推進
  • 設備の負荷管理及び設備更新• 増設の計画
  • 設備劣化状況の把握及び維持• 更新の計画
  • 専門技術• 知識の開発, 実行, 共有
  • 技術レポートの作成• 論文の発表
  • トレーニング資料の作成及び開発
  • 業務改善の実施と問題解決への貢献
  • ファシリティー監視システムの提供, オペレーション上のトラブルサポート, トラブル解析
  • FMEAによるリスク解析
  • Tableau• Power BI等のツールを使用してのデーター作成• 管理
  • AIを使用しての業務改善改善活動

Supplementary code:
Plans facilities changes for plant, office, and production equipment layouts, working toward economy of operation, maximum use of facilities and equipment, and compliance with laws and regulations. Coordinates with architecture/engineering firms in developing design criteria and preparing layout and detail drawings. Prepares bid sheets and contracts for construction and facilities acquisition. Reviews and estimates design costs including equipment, installation, labor, materials, preparation and other related costs. Inspects construction and installation progress for conformance to established drawings, specifications, and schedules. Develops criteria and performance specifications required to meet unique operating requirements and building and safety codes.

Micron Technology Compensation & Benefits Highlights

  • Retirement Support A dollar-for-dollar 401(k) match up to 5% of pay, with pre-tax, Roth, and after-tax options, and access to retirement planning tools underpin long-term savings. Recent materials also note student-loan match integration counted toward the same 5% cap.
  • Equity Value & Accessibility An Employee Stock Purchase Plan offers a 15% discount on Micron shares, and eligible roles may receive RSUs at management discretion alongside performance bonuses. Stock and incentive components can materially lift total compensation in stronger business cycles.
  • Healthcare Strength Comprehensive medical, dental, and vision options are paired with onsite or near-site health centers at many U.S. locations, an EAP with free counseling sessions, and employer HSA seed-and-match contributions. 2026 options include Blue Cross and Cigna (plus Kaiser HMO in select sites), and Boise’s onsite clinic lists about a $10 copay for covered members.
